The Intel Core i9-10900 has 10 cores and 20 threads with maximum working frequency of 5.20 GHz. The Intel Core i9-10900 was released on Q2/2020.

The Intel Xeon W-1270 has 8 cores with 20 threads and 5.20 GHz of frequency. The Intel Xeon W-1270 was released on Q2/2020.

Thermal Management

Let's find out what TDP value would be better for Intel Core i9-10900 or Intel Xeon W-1270? The Thermal Design Power (TDP) indicates the maximum amount of heat that should be dissipated by the chip cooling system. However, the value of TDP gives only a rough indication of the real power consumption of the CPU.

  • TDP (PL1)
    65 W left arrow 80 W
  • Tjunction max.
    100 °C left arrow 100 °C
